    I have a PC here and the owner is convinced he has "Trojan.Brisv.A!". I have run scans with SuperAntiSpyware, Malware Bytes, AVG8, Defender, AntiVir, and I'm scanning right now with Symantec's Trojan.Brisv Removal Tool (link: http://www.symantec.com/security_response/writeup.jsp?docid=2008-071823-1655-99&tabid=1). So far, each scan has come up completely clean except for some cookies and a false positive by AVG on some AT&T software. From the little research I've done, this particular trojan isn't 'smart' enough to avoid detection from 5 different, quality malware scanners.... I'm 95% sure the system is not infected (I'll know for sure after the Symantec tool finishes). Anybody have any thoughts?

    That's a good question.... but..... :-o I think he was right rolleyes The Symantic removal tool just finished scanning and it turns out he's been downloading from Limewire and in the "Incomplete" folder are about 10 infected songs.
